
Biography
Debbie Jones is a clinical professor at the School of Optometry and Vision Science and a lead clinical scientist at the Centre for Ocular Research & Education (CORE), at the University of À¶Ý®ÊÓÆµ.
Her main area of clinical focus is in pediatric optometry and her main area of research activity is in the area of myopia control.
Debbie has a keen interest in the eyecare needs of indigenous peoples and has provided eyecare to a remote community in Northern Ontario on a number of occasions.
Trained in the UK, Debbie has been a faculty member at the School of Optometry and Vision Science since 1998. She is formally a partner in an award winning private practice in the UK and has published articles in optometric journals and regularly presents at optometric conferences worldwide. She is a Fellow of the British College of Optometrists, the British Contact Lens Association and also of the American Academy of Optometry.
